Great Britain, Edward VIII, fantasy medallic crowns, undated (1937), issued c2012 in silver (only 12 minted), nickel silver, aluminium, gold coated alloy, platinum coated alloy, piedfort copper, piedfort silver coated, piedfort gold coated (38mm), all milled edge, obverse, head of Edward VIII left by D.R.G. (D.R.Golder), reverse, crowned coat of arms within a garter, issued by International Numismatic Agencies. Proof-like uncirculated. (8)

Ex Ian McCutcheon Collection.
